I had an iphon 3g for literally a year, and it got stolen off of me in broad daylight on the 2nd of July. However through insurance (thank god), I recieved a new phone and sim the following day... now the problems start...
I synced the phone to itunes 8.2 and it said the iphone could not restore back up, as the software is too old (my old phone was 3.0 and the new one obviously 2.2.1).
It then said I needed to set the phone up as a new iphone, which I did. However, after doing this and choosing to restore back up, it only gives me the option of restoring iphone to "Jahangeer's iphone" and one restoring date, 10th april 09! How can that be when I only last synched and backed up my old iphone 3g a week before it was stolen?!

I'm pulling my hair out trying to figure out how to solve the problem. Any ideas/help would extremely be appreciated!!!

Restore to 3.0 and then restore from backup :)

So you've got your stuff back, yes? OK, jailbreak your phone, install OpenSSH and manually backup your messages, photos etc. If you need help on this, ask.
Delete all the old backups in iTunes, restore your iPhone and then jailbreak again and restore your stuff manually then backup!
